Joanne was admitted as an advocate and solicitor of the High Court of Malaya in 2009. Prior to that, she graduated with a Bachelor of Laws degree from the University of Liverpool and was subsequently called to the Bar of England and Wales in 2008.
She mainly handles litigation matters concerning family disputes where she garnered experience from highly contentious matrimonial proceedings involving cross border divorce, custody of children, interfaith conversions & division of matrimonial assets which are repeatedly reported in the Malaysian legal journals and leading local newspapers. Although her practice primarily focuses on matrimonial disputes, she has a wide-ranging expertise in representing individuals on matters relating to contested probate and defamation.
She also partakes in public interest litigations which many are recognised as landmark cases both in Malaysia and internationally.
